By Type:The market is segmented into various types, including spices, herbs, blends, seasoning sauces, marinades, rubs, and others. Among these, spices dominate the market due to their essential role in flavoring and preserving food. The increasing trend of home cooking and the growing popularity of ethnic cuisines have led to a surge in demand for diverse spice varieties. Consumers are increasingly seeking unique flavors, which has resulted in a significant rise in the availability and consumption of spices.

By End-User:The end-user segmentation includes retail consumers, food service providers, food manufacturers, catering services, and others. Retail consumers represent the largest segment, driven by the increasing trend of home cooking and the desire for flavorful meals. The rise of cooking shows and social media platforms showcasing culinary creativity has encouraged consumers to experiment with various seasonings, leading to a higher demand in retail settings.

The US Seasonings Market is valued at approximately USD 3 billion, reflecting a five-year historical analysis. This growth is driven by increasing demand for clean-label and organic seasoning options, as well as a rise in home cooking and culinary exploration.
